Regional Support Official

We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Regional Support Official to join our team in the North West region. As a key member of our team, you will play a vital role in ensuring the consistent implementation of our bargaining, campaigning, and organising objectives.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Assist in securing and maintaining recognition of our trade union in the designated area
  • Conduct and support negotiations with employing institutions in accordance with nationally and locally agreed bargaining objectives
  • Contribute to the organisation and effective delivery of regional training in accordance with our national training programme
  • Engage in and organise regional and local campaigning activities in accordance with national/regional campaigning objectives
  • Deputise for the Regional Official as necessary
Requirements:
  • Educated to GCSE level (inc. maths & English) or equivalent
  • Experience of a similar working environment and/or understanding of working for a trade union or other not-for-profit organisation
  • Good knowledge of the post-compulsory education sector; a working knowledge and understanding of employment law, as well as trade union organising experience
  • Excellent interpersonal skills, able to advocate on behalf of members and represent individuals in disciplinary and grievance cases
  • Ability to travel across the region
Benefits:
  • Supportive Family Policies: Embrace family life with enhanced Maternity, Adoption, Paternity, and Shared Parental Leave schemes
  • Health and Well-being Support: Access to confidential counselling 24/7 through our Employee Assistance Programme; advice and face-to-face intervention from via our Physiotherapy Advice Line; healthcare assessment
  • Flexible Working: Take advantage of our Flexitime scheme, allowing you to tailor your work hours within our Work Life Balance policy
  • Financial Assistance: Benefit from being enrolled in the Universities Superannuation Scheme (USS), childcare support, interest-free season ticket loans, and assistance with the cost of eyesight testing and glasses for DSE use
  • Training and Development: Elevate your skills with tailored training, developmental support, and over 300 eLearning modules available through our online Training Room
